## Releases

Heads up, plugin folks: Digestdeck (our batch email digest scheduler) cuts releases every other Thursday. Your plugin needs to target the current scheduler API version or the loader will just skip it — no drama, it only logs a warning. We sign every release tarball, so please verify before building against it. The public key we sign releases with is right here.

rollout seal: bky4_x7Gc

On-call note: the Brindlewick firmware update channel for Pellet-series thermostats stalled during the nightly canary push. The staging signer rotated its key mid-run, so devices rejected the manifest as untrusted and fell back to the previous image, which is the intended safe behavior. We re-signed the manifest, verified checksums on three canary devices, and resumed rollout at 5% with a four-hour hold. Watch for repeated fallback events in the channel dashboard. The interrupted run is identified by the trace below.

pipeline stamp: htk31_f769b577b3028a4e9958e5bb8d1259a

Handover Note — Halvern Works Capacity Decision

Rena,

Before I roll off, a quick download for you and the sales leads. We've been sitting on the question of whether to add a third shift at the Halvern plant or shift overflow to the Dorset Vale facility. My gut says Dorset Vale — cheaper, faster to spin up, and the union talks there are in a good place. Sales should hold off quoting Q3 volumes above current capacity until this lands. One more thing, strictly between us:

internal memo for hahif-hahaf: Headcount on the Zorwyn team goes from 9 to 100 by the end of October. Gross margin on Zorwyn came in at 5 percent against a plan of 10 percent.

# --- Password Reset Revamp (Project Larkspur) ---
# On-call notes. New flow writes reset tokens to the
# tokens_v2 table; old table is read-only until cutover.
# If token validation errors spike, flip LARKSPUR_LEGACY=1
# and page the auth squad. Do not truncate tokens_v2.
# Rate limiter shares this DB — watch lock waits.
# Token store requires the connection string that follows.

primary connection of yagep-kahip = redis://giliel_svc:zYiKsLL2PLpfPL@db-348f.xolmarsys.corp:5432/fenwyn